Our workmanship
is from generations of experience. We have learned from our fathers
how to create quality furniture that will last.
The three
of us at Our Woodshop are proud of what we make and the way we make
things. We never use the so called "engineered lumber" or what I consider
glorified cardboard like you find in so many kinds of furniture now
a days. We even shy away from most plywood, and if we do use it, it
is the good stuff.
Most of the
things we make are made of nothing but real honest to goodness natural
wood boards. We use
mostly pine, poplar, oak, cherry and old barn siding, but if you want
something else, we can do that too. We hand select the lumber to get
the best stock available. I
buy hard woods directly from the man that
cut down the tree.
Also, we
use a Kreg Jig to make pocket holes and screws things together so that
things will be good and tight for generations. (We buy screws 15000
at a time...) I made one cabinet and when I had the shell done, just
for kicks I counted the screws, there were 95!
We don't
have an assembly line and most things are made by one of us from beginning
to end. We're proud of the things we make and love the thought that
what we make will be passed down from generation to generation.
